                          Thomas Braun Most Active @C3PO last edited by Thomas Braun

                          @C3PO sagte in neu installierter ioBroker über Browser nicht erreichbar:

                          tcp 1 0 0.0.0.0:9001 0.0.0.0:* LISTEN 0 14527 718/mosquitto

                          Der Port 9001 ist bei dir schon von mosquitto blockiert. Da läuft beim iobroker das:

                          tcp        0      0 127.0.0.1:9001          0.0.0.0:*               LISTEN      1001       16990      704/iobroker.js-con

                                      • apollon77
                                        apollon77 @Thomas Braun last edited by

                                        @Thomas-Braun iobroker setup custom ... da kann der port angegeben werden

                                            C3PO @apollon77 last edited by

                                            @apollon77

                                            Es war der Port 🙂

                                            hab jetzt 9001 zu 9101 und 9000 zu 9100 gemacht.

                                            Sind die ports in Adaptern hart kodiert?
